#56f979 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#56f979 is composed of 33.7% red, 97.6%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 132.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 65.7%. #56f979 color hex could be obtained by blending #acfff2 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

● #56f979 color description : Soft lime green.
The hexadecimal color #56f979 has RGB values of R:86, G:249,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5699961.
